招商银行(600036):非息降幅收窄 营收业绩环比改善
Xin Lang Cai Jing· 2025-09-01 00:29
Core Viewpoint - The company reported a slight decline in revenue for the first half of 2025, but net profit showed a modest increase, indicating resilience in its financial performance despite challenging market conditions [1] Financial Performance - The company achieved a revenue of 169.97 billion yuan in 1H25, a year-on-year decrease of 1.7%, with the decline narrowing by 1.4 percentage points compared to 1Q25 [1] - The net profit attributable to shareholders was 74.93 billion yuan, reflecting a year-on-year increase of 0.3%, with growth accelerating by 2.3 percentage points from 1Q25 [1] - The net interest margin stood at 1.63%, down 12 basis points year-on-year, but the decline was less severe than the 17 basis points drop in 2024 [1] Income Sources - Net interest income grew by 1.6% year-on-year to 106.09 billion yuan, supported by volume despite a slight drag from net interest margin [2] - Non-interest income saw a reduced decline, with net commission and fee income at 37.6 billion yuan, down 1.9% year-on-year, an improvement from the 2.5% decline in 1Q25 [2] - Investment income increased by 12.3% year-on-year to 21.89 billion yuan, contributing to a narrowing of the decline in other non-interest income [2] Loan Growth and Quality - The loan balance reached 7.1166 trillion yuan at the end of 1H25, a year-on-year increase of 5.5%, slightly lower than the 5.8% growth at the end of 2024 [3] - Corporate loans grew by 11.5% to 3.0897 trillion yuan, with manufacturing loans increasing by 18.4%, while real estate loans continued to decline by 8.3% [3] - Retail loans increased by 3.9% to 3.6782 trillion yuan, with a slowdown attributed to external factors affecting consumer leverage [3] Cost of Liabilities and Asset Quality - The net interest margin was 1.88%, down 12 basis points year-on-year, but the decline was less than the previous year's [4] - The cost of interest-bearing liabilities decreased by 37 basis points to 1.35%, reflecting effective management of funding costs [4] - The non-performing loan ratio was 0.93% at the end of 1H25, stable compared to 1Q25, with corporate non-performing loans improving while retail non-performing loans showed slight increases [4] Investment Outlook - The company is expected to continue benefiting from its wealth management strategy, with strong growth in retail assets under management, suggesting potential for sustained performance improvement as the economy recovers [5]
中国银行上半年营收3294亿元 行长张辉:将持续改善资产负债结构,加大非利息收入拓展力度
Mei Ri Jing Ji Xin Wen· 2025-08-31 07:53
Core Viewpoint - China Bank reported a stable performance in the first half of 2025, with a year-on-year revenue growth of 3.61% and a net profit of 126.1 billion yuan, indicating a positive trend compared to the first quarter [1][3]. Financial Performance - The group achieved an operating income of 329.4 billion yuan, with net interest income of 214.8 billion yuan and non-interest income of 114.6 billion yuan [3][4]. - The net profit attributable to shareholders was 117.6 billion yuan, showing stability compared to the previous year [1][3]. - Key financial ratios included a net interest margin of 1.26%, return on assets (ROA) of 0.70%, and return on equity (ROE) of 9.11% [1][3]. Non-Interest Income Growth - Non-interest income accounted for over 30% of total operating income, with net fee income reaching 46.8 billion yuan, reflecting a 9.17% increase [4][5]. - The bank's strategy focuses on enhancing non-interest income through wealth management and customer service, with significant growth in fund distribution fees and insurance services [4][5]. Strategic Focus - The bank aims to optimize its asset-liability structure and expand non-interest income in response to the low interest rate environment [4][6]. - Emphasis is placed on customer and account expansion, with a 5.8% increase in domestic settlement fees and a 25.3% rise in bond underwriting fees [5][6]. Market Conditions and Outlook - The bank faces challenges from a low interest rate environment, with expectations of continued pressure on net interest margins due to external market conditions [7][8]. - Strategies include enhancing loan management, optimizing product structures, and increasing foreign currency bond investments to improve asset yield [8][9].
沪农商行(601825):存款成本优化显效 中期分红比例提升
Xin Lang Cai Jing· 2025-08-31 06:32
Core Viewpoint - The company shows signs of recovery with positive growth in revenue and net profit in Q2 2025, driven by stable scale growth and an increase in non-interest income [1][3] Group 1: Financial Performance - In H1 2025, the company's revenue decreased by 3.4% year-on-year, but the non-recurring revenue increased by 0.38% [1] - The net profit attributable to shareholders increased by 0.6% year-on-year, showing improvement from Q1 [1] - The annualized weighted average ROE was 11.11%, down by 0.78 percentage points year-on-year [1] - In Q2, revenue and net profit grew by 0.76% and 0.86% year-on-year, respectively, indicating a gradual improvement in performance [1] Group 2: Interest Income and Loan Growth - The company's net interest income decreased by 5.45% year-on-year, but the decline has narrowed [2] - The net interest margin (NIM) was 1.39%, down by 11 basis points from the beginning of the year [2] - Total loans increased by 2.51% year-to-date, with corporate loans being the main growth driver, up by 5.12% [2] - Retail loans decreased by 1.69% year-to-date, with mortgage loans showing a positive growth of 1.89% [2] Group 3: Non-Interest Income and Asset Quality - Non-interest income increased by 2.19% year-on-year, with a positive growth trend in Q1 [3] - Investment income surged by 44.63%, contributing significantly to the non-interest income growth [3] - The non-performing loan (NPL) ratio was stable at 0.97% as of June, with a decrease in corporate NPLs [3] - The company maintained a strong provision coverage ratio of 336.55%, indicating sufficient risk mitigation capacity [3] Group 4: Strategic Positioning and Shareholder Returns - The company has a strong presence in Shanghai, leveraging its regional advantages [4] - The company is focusing on enhancing shareholder returns, with a mid-year dividend payout ratio of 33.14%, an increase from the previous year [4] - The company is expected to maintain a solid asset quality and risk mitigation capability while transitioning towards retail finance and light capital models [4]

招商银行(600036)2025年一季报点评:归母净利润同比小幅下滑 存款成本继续优化
Xin Lang Cai Jing· 2025-05-06 00:25
Core Viewpoint - In Q1 2025, China Merchants Bank reported a decline in both operating income and net profit, indicating a slowdown in performance compared to the previous year [1][2]. Financial Performance - In Q1 2025, the bank achieved operating income of 83.751 billion yuan, a year-on-year decrease of 3.09%, with the decline rate widening by 2.61 percentage points compared to 2024 [1][2]. - The net profit attributable to shareholders was 37.286 billion yuan, down 2.08% year-on-year, with a decline of 3.3 percentage points compared to 2024 [1][2]. - The average return on total assets and average return on equity were 1.21% and 14.13%, respectively, both showing year-on-year declines of 0.14 percentage points and 1.95 percentage points [2]. Revenue Structure - Net interest income for Q1 2025 was 52.996 billion yuan, reflecting a year-on-year growth of 1.92%, continuing the growth trend from Q4 2024 [2]. - Net fee and commission income was 19.696 billion yuan, down 2.51% year-on-year, with wealth management fees increasing by 10.45% [2]. - The revenue from agency wealth management surged by 39.47% due to growth in agency scale and product structure optimization, while agency insurance income continued to decline due to falling insurance sales [2]. - Other net income was 11.059 billion yuan, down 22.19% year-on-year, primarily impacted by rising market interest rates leading to a decrease in the fair value of bond and fund investments [2]. Cost Management - The net interest margin for Q1 2025 was 1.91%, down 11 basis points year-on-year and 3 basis points quarter-on-quarter, with the decline rate narrowing [3]. - The deposit cost rate decreased by 34 basis points year-on-year to 1.29%, positively affecting the net interest margin due to lower deposit rates and regulatory restrictions on high-interest deposit solicitation [3]. Asset Quality - As of the end of Q1 2025, the non-performing loan ratio was 0.94%, a slight improvement of 0.01 percentage points from the end of the previous year [3]. - The non-performing loan ratio for corporate loans improved to 0.95%, while the retail loan non-performing ratio increased to 1.01%, indicating ongoing pressure on retail loan asset quality [3]. - The provision coverage ratio was 410.03%, down 1.95 percentage points from the end of the previous year [3]. Investment Outlook - The bank maintains a "buy" rating, with a dividend payout ratio exceeding 30% and a projected cash dividend of 2 yuan per share for 2024, resulting in a dividend yield of 4.91% based on the closing price on April 30 [4]. - The estimated net asset value per share for 2025 is 45.25 yuan, with the current stock price corresponding to a price-to-book ratio of 0.90 times [4].
招商银行一季度营收利润双降,财富中收回暖成亮点
2 1 Shi Ji Jing Ji Bao Dao· 2025-04-29 13:37
Core Viewpoint - The first quarter report of China Merchants Bank (CMB) shows a decline in both revenue and net profit, but there are signs of recovery in wealth management fees, indicating a potential stabilization in the bank's financial performance [1][4]. Financial Performance - CMB reported operating revenue of 83.751 billion yuan, a year-on-year decrease of 3.09%, and net profit of 37.513 billion yuan, down 2.08% [1]. - The non-performing loan ratio decreased by 0.01 percentage points to 0.94% compared to the end of the previous year [1]. - The net interest margin (NIM) fell to 1.91%, down 11 basis points year-on-year and 3 basis points quarter-on-quarter [1][2]. Wealth Management and Non-Interest Income - Non-interest net income was 30.755 billion yuan, a year-on-year decrease of 10.64%, accounting for 36.72% of total revenue [4]. - Wealth management fees showed improvement, with a 10.45% year-on-year increase in wealth management commission income to 6.783 billion yuan, reversing a previous decline [4][5]. - The bank's commission income from selling financial products, such as wealth management and insurance, remains under pressure due to market conditions [5][6]. Deposit Composition and Strategy - The proportion of demand deposits increased to 51.80%, with corporate demand deposits making up 58.06% and retail demand deposits 41.94% [2]. - The average daily balance of demand deposits accounted for 50.46% of the average daily balance of customer deposits, reflecting a slight increase from the previous year [2]. Market Activity and Shareholder Engagement - The Hong Kong Central Clearing Limited account increased its holdings of CMB shares by approximately 128 million shares during the first quarter [7]. - CMB's average return on total assets (ROAA) and average return on equity (ROAE) were 1.21% and 14.13%, respectively, both showing a year-on-year decline [7]. Management Outlook - CMB's management aims to stabilize the net interest margin and improve the commission income from wealth management, contingent on the overall stabilization of the capital market [6][7]. - The bank is cautious about increasing dividends to maintain a balance between return on equity and capital adequacy [7].
招商银行(600036):负债成本优化 分红率领先同业
Xin Lang Cai Jing· 2025-03-27 08:31
Core Insights - The company reported a year-on-year revenue decline of 0.48% for 2024, but a net profit increase of 1.22%, showing improvement compared to the first three quarters of 2024 [1] - In Q4 2024, revenue grew by 7.53% year-on-year, and net profit increased by 7.63%, indicating a positive turnaround from Q3 2024 [1] Financial Performance - The company's net interest income decreased by 1.58% year-on-year, but Q4 2024 saw a 3.05% increase compared to the same quarter last year [2] - The net interest margin (NIM) for 2024 was 1.98%, down 17 basis points from 2023, primarily due to declining loan yields [2] - Total loans increased by 5.83% year-on-year, with corporate loans growing by 10.15% and retail loans by 6.01%, driven by a significant rise in personal consumption loans [2] Non-Interest Income - Non-interest income rose by 1.41% year-on-year, returning to positive growth, with wealth management income declining by 22.7% due to fee reductions [3] - The company saw a remarkable 44.84% increase in income from agency sales of financial products, supported by scale and product optimization [3] - Other non-interest income surged by 34.13%, primarily from investment income and changes in public charging value [3] Asset Quality - The non-performing loan (NPL) ratio stood at 0.95% at the end of 2024, with a slight increase in retail loan NPLs [3] - The company maintained a strong provision coverage ratio of 411.98%, indicating robust risk mitigation capabilities [3] Investment Strategy - The company aims to balance quality, efficiency, and scale in its value banking strategy, with a focus on retail financial advantages and enhanced core capabilities in wealth management and risk management [4] - A dividend payout ratio of 35.32% for 2024 is planned, with intentions to implement a mid-term dividend in 2025 [4] - The projected book value per share (BVPS) for 2025-2027 is expected to be 45.43, 49.63, and 53.96 respectively, with corresponding price-to-book (PB) ratios of 0.94X, 0.86X, and 0.79X [4]
